Biography
Detroit rapper BandGang Lonnie Bands exemplifies the pinnacle of street rap through potent narrative lyrics and ceaseless rhythmic delivery. He emerged as one of the most promising figures among the original six-man BandGang crew, attaining broader visibility through standalone releases highlighted by the 2021 mixtape Hard 2 Kill and later efforts such as 2023's Bam Bam.
BandGang Lonnie Bands first took up rapping at age 13 within the BandGang collective. Over the course of the 2010s the crew built a stronger regional presence via partnerships with acts including SOB X RBE and fellow Detroiter Tee Grizzley. His solo career opened with the 2016 EP Talk That Shit, which he promptly followed with projects like 2017's Antisocial before asserting his status as Detroit's ruler on the 2019 album KOD.
After enduring multiple personal tragedies that claimed friends and family members, Lonnie Bands briefly stepped back from music, only to rediscover his drive with the 2021 mixtape Hard 2 Kill. He resumed a consistent pace of solo work, collaborations, and guest appearances, issuing an expanded edition of Hard 2 Kill in 2022 and, in 2023, both the mixtape Bam Bam and the joint project We Brought Detroit to LA with Cypress Moreno.
